Output 755e53aa1046be701d379edf5f760fe1f790b2b2c6ae61d1a54058a2ba233f61:13

value
40475739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10ea1b195bfa71ecfae8c3e9525ee929f2d5223c OP_EQUAL
address
33ETBaC1naVDY8TNWMKAhfJ7hbuuqFZGUY
transaction
755e53aa1046be701d379edf5f760fe1f790b2b2c6ae61d1a54058a2ba233f61
confirmations
338570
spent
true